No, William Shakespeare was not a girl; he was a male playwright and poet born in 1564 in Stratford-upon-Avon, England. He is widely regarded as one of the greatest writers in the English language and is known for his influential works, including plays like "Hamlet," "Romeo and Juliet," and "Macbeth." Shakespeare's gender is well-documented in historical records.
